What is BS EN 61439-1 - Low-voltage switchgear and controlgear assemblies about?
BS EN 61439-1 is a British standard as a part of the IEC 61439 series that lays down the definitions and states the service conditions, construction requirements, technical characteristics, and verification requirements for low-voltage switchgear and control gear assemblies.
BS EN 61439-1 applies to low-voltage switchgear and control gear assemblies only when required by the relevant assembly standard as follows:
- Assemblies for which the rated voltage does not exceed 1 000 V in case of a.c. Or 1 500 V in case of d.c.
- Stationary or movable assemblies with or without an enclosure
- Assemblies intended for use in connection with the generation, transmission, distribution, and conversion of electric energy, and for the control of electric energy consuming equipment
- Assemblies designed for use under special service conditions, for example in ships and in rail vehicles provided that the other relevant specific requirements are complied with
- Assemblies designed for electrical equipment of machines provided that the other relevant specific requirements are complied with
BS EN 61439-1 applies to all assemblies whether they are designed, manufactured, and verified on a one-off basis or fully standardized and manufactured in quantity.
Note 1: Throughout BS EN 61439-1, the term assembly is used for low-voltage switchgear and control gear assembly.
Note 2: BS EN 61439-1 does not apply to individual devices and self-contained components, such as motor starters, fuse switches, electronic equipment, etc. which will comply with the relevant product standards.

Why should you use BS EN 61439-1 - Low-voltage switchgear and controlgear assemblies?
Effective switchgear will activate in the event of an electrical surge, halting the flow of power and safeguarding the electrical systems from damage. De-energizing equipment for safe testing, maintenance, and fault clearing is also done with switchgear. Control gear refers to the switches, fuses, and circuit breakers that are used to regulate, protect, and isolate electrical equipment. The purpose of BS EN 61439-1 is to harmonize as far as practicable all rules and requirements of a general nature applicable to low-voltage switchgear and control gear assemblies in order to obtain uniformity of requirements and verification for assemblies and to avoid the need for verification to other standards.
BS EN 61439-1 provides you with the interface characteristics, constructional and performance requirements, degree of protection provided by an assembly enclosure, and protection against electric shocks. Using BS EN 61439-1 guidelines helps maintain the safety and protection of the user and ensures uniform classification systems, reliability, and durability for long service life.
What’s changed since the last update?
BS EN 61439-1:2011 supersedes EN 61439-1:2009, which is withdrawn. BS EN 61439-1:2011 includes some technical changes with respect to EN 61439-1:2009. These include:
- Revision of service conditions in Clause 7
- Numerous changes regarding verification methods in Clause 10
- Modification of routine verification in respect of clearances and creepage distances (see 11.3)
- Adaption of the tables in Annex C and Annex D to the revised requirements and verification methods
- Shifting of tables from Annex H to new Annex N
